In saying that, the one thing you should keep in mind about grinding dance techniques is that the focus is always on the hips. Nothing to do with fancy footwork. It's all in the hips.
By focusing on the hips alone, instead of footwork, you'll be able to move to the beat of the music without destroying the mood by toe stepping sort of thing.
Anyhow, in order to gently ease into a grinding dance routine with a girl, (remember not all girls like this style of dance), you'll want to find out if it's ok to go on. To find this out, without putting a girl in an uncomfortable position...here's how to go about it.
Initiate this by starting face to face with the girl. Don't go straight in and start right away. Ease into it. The reason is what was mentioned earlier. Not all girls appreciate this dance style. So you first want to establish that point first. To do this just take her by the hand, right or left, and initiate a twirl. Sort of what you'll see from ballroom type dancing. Do this elegantly.
At that point, keep a hold of her hand and move closer when she's turned around. Before she completes the twirl.
Now you're both set for grind dancing. This is the stage that you need to establish if she's comfortable with this dance style.
That little twirl is all it would take to find that out.
The reason this method seems a bit more comfortable is by creating a sort of cross armed hugging, notion because your partner will have her arms crossed from the spin, which will let her feel more at ease.
This kind of position is known to create a level of comfort.
At this stage, keep hand to hand contact and start to ease into some grinding dance moves. Don't force this remember. Just move naturally and with rhythm, swaying your hips in tandem with your partners to the beat of the music.
If you start to sense discomfort you can just as easily break out of the grinding dance position as easily as you initiated it.
To do this you just reverse the move you done to initiate it. Take her hand and spin her back out to return face to face with you.
By using this method you can easily avoid generating any sort of feeling of unease between you both.
